📉 Rapeseed and Canola Under Pressure as Trade Disruptions Shake Markets
📍 Oilseed markets faced another challenging session, with rapeseed and canola struggling under mounting trade tensions and shifting global supply chains. While soybeans attempted a modest recovery, pressure from expanding Brazilian exports and demand shifts in China kept the market on edge. As geopolitical uncertainties grow, traders closely watch how key players adjust their buying strategies.

🌍 2. Market Drivers & Influencing Factors
📌 Key Market Developments
- Trade Disruptions Impact Global Supply Chains 🌍
→ China’s trade actions against Canada sent shockwaves, forcing buyers to look for alternative suppliers.
→ Rapeseed and canola markets struggled as uncertainty loomed over export demand. - Brazil’s Soybean Export Boom Continues 🚢
→ Brazil’s harvest progress and record export pace are putting pressure on global soybean prices.
→ China is shifting purchases away from U.S. soybeans, raising questions about future demand patterns. - USDA WASDE Report Adjusts Global Supply Expectations 📊
→ Soybean stocks have been revised downward, reflecting stronger-than-expected processing demand in key markets.
→ Trade flows remain a major concern, with shifting alliances reshaping the global oilseed landscape.

🔍 6. Key Takeaways & Recommendations
📉 Market Insights:
- Uncertainty continues to weigh on rapeseed and canola markets as trade tensions reshape supply chains.
- Soybeans struggle against strong Brazilian competition, with China reducing U.S. imports.
- Market volatility remains high, with traders watching for further geopolitical developments.
🔮 The market remains on edge – key factors to monitor include China’s evolving trade strategy and South American harvest progress.
